Turkey has a sparse and frustrating train system, but flights are cheap, and competitive bus companies provide easy, comfy and inexpensive connections throughout the land. Cappadocia is rightly famous for its fantastic land formations and labyrinthine cave dwellings going back to early Christian days. It's...

Famous Japanese photographer Masakazu Akagi, who is serving as a private photographer for Japanese Prince Tohomito, has been in Turkey for 50 days to photograph underwater beauties around the Aegean town of Muğla. His videos will be aired on Japanese national television and photos will be published in various international magazines. 8220;When I learned...

Istanbul is a city of constancy and contrast - at once historic and cutting-edge contemporary. It is the world's only city to straddle two continents: the Thracian side dipping Turkey's big toe in Europe while the rest of the city, and indeed the country, bathes luxuriously in Asia. It also reflects the modern, secular, republican country envisaged by the father of modern Turkey.

Investors looking for an overseas property investment may want to consider the options available in Turkey. Partner at Emerging Real Estate Tim Morgan noted Turkey's economy is experiencing strong growth, with both house prices and rental values rising during 2011. Tourism has been driving the boom in Turkey and savvy investors are recognising that buy-to-let properties here will be very profitable," he stated.
